“He tells us everything over and over – one line at a time, one line at a time, a little here, and a little there!” (Isaiah 28:10, NLT)
“Equipped with the right tools, we can learn to listen to God. What are those tools?
A regular time and place. Select a slot on your schedule and a corner of your world, and claim it for God.
A second tool you need is an open Bible. God speaks to us through his Word.
There is a third tool … we need a listening heart. Spend time listening for him until you receive your lesson for the day – then apply it.
(from Grace For The Moment, by Max Lucado, page 150)
